Transaction f705f05171a6156d30bdbb6bffaa4eae9bc907ebfbd0b6d5fbba64096bce5102
1 Input
1 Output
-
f705f05171a6156d30bdbb6bffaa4eae9bc907ebfbd0b6d5fbba64096bce5102:0
- value
- 23124095
- script pubkey
- OP_0 OP_PUSHBYTES_20 89ccee3dc2e52656038c79af843632f28d6a32db
- address
- bc1q38xwu0wzu5n9vquv0xhcgd3j72xk5vkmltv79m